Trade Management Software Market is anticipated to expand from $1.38 billion in 2024 to $2.07 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of approximately 4.1%. The Trade Management Software Market encompasses digital solutions designed to streamline international trade operations, including compliance, logistics, and documentation. These platforms enhance efficiency by automating trade processes, ensuring regulatory adherence, and optimizing supply chain visibility. Increasing globalization and complex trade regulations drive demand for sophisticated software solutions, fostering innovation in data analytics, cloud integration, and real-time tracking technologies.
The Trade Management Software Market is experiencing robust expansion, fueled by the increasing complexity of global trade regulations and supply chain operations. The software segment is leading in performance, with trade compliance solutions and risk management tools being pivotal for mitigating regulatory risks. Automation and analytics capabilities within these solutions are enhancing decision-making and operational efficiency. The second highest performing segment comprises supply chain visibility and inventory management tools, reflecting the growing need for real-time insights and optimization in logistics. Cloud-based trade management solutions are gaining momentum due to their scalability and ease of integration with existing systems, while on-premise solutions continue to hold significance for organizations prioritizing data security and control. Hybrid solutions are emerging as a strategic choice, balancing flexibility with robust security measures. Furthermore, the increasing adoption of AI and machine learning within trade management software is driving innovation, enabling predictive analytics and smarter, automated decision-making processes.

Tariff Impact:
The Trade Management Software Market is intricately influenced by global tariffs and geopolitical tensions, particularly in East Asia. Japan and South Korea are navigating US-China trade frictions by enhancing their digital trade infrastructures and investing in AI-driven compliance tools. China, under increasing export controls, is advancing its trade software capabilities to support its 'dual circulation' strategy. Taiwan, while critical in semiconductor supply, faces challenges due to its geopolitical positioning, prompting a focus on robust trade compliance systems. Globally, the parent market is experiencing steady growth, driven by digital transformation initiatives. By 2035, the market is anticipated to evolve with enhanced automation and AI integration. Middle East conflicts continue to disrupt global supply chains and elevate energy prices, impacting operational costs and strategic planning.
